Diya Alsafadi is a scholar working on Pollution, Biomaterials and Molecular Biology. According to data from OpenAlex, Diya Alsafadi has authored 24 papers receiving a total of 548 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Pollution, 10 papers in Biomaterials and 6 papers in Molecular Biology. Recurrent topics in Diya Alsafadi's work include biodegradable polymer synthesis and properties (9 papers), Enzyme Catalysis and Immobilization (6 papers) and Microbial Metabolic Engineering and Bioproduction (5 papers). Diya Alsafadi is often cited by papers focused on biodegradable polymer synthesis and properties (9 papers), Enzyme Catalysis and Immobilization (6 papers) and Microbial Metabolic Engineering and Bioproduction (5 papers). Diya Alsafadi collaborates with scholars based in Jordan, Saudi Arabia and United Kingdom. Diya Alsafadi's co-authors include Othman Al‐Mashaqbeh, Francesca Paradisi, Mahmoud A. Hussein, Khalid A. Alamry, Shannon L. Bartelt‐Hunt, Daniel D. Snow, Sahar Dalahmeh, Susan Liddell, Jennifer Cassidy and Thorsten Allers and has published in prestigious journals such as The Science of The Total Environment, Scientific Reports and Carbohydrate Polymers.
